(* mips_wrappers.sail: wrappers functions and hooks for CHERI extensibility 
   (mostly identity functions here) *)

function unit effect {wmem} MEMw_wrapper(addr, size, data) = 
    let ledata = reverse_endianness(data) in
    if (addr == 0x000000007f000000) then
      {
        UART_WDATA   := ledata[7..0];
        UART_WRITTEN := 1;
      } else {
        MEMea(addr, size);
        MEMval(addr, size, ledata);
      }

function bool effect {wmem} MEMw_conditional_wrapper(addr, size, data) =
    {
      MEMea_conditional(addr, size);
      MEMval_conditional(addr, size, reverse_endianness(data))
    }

function bit[64] addrWrapper((bit[64]) addr, (MemAccessType) accessType, (WordType) width) =
    addr

function (bit[64]) TranslatePC ((bit[64]) vAddr) = {
    incrementCP0Count();
    if (vAddr[1..0] != 0b00) then (* bad PC alignment *)
      (SignalExceptionBadAddr(AdEL, vAddr))
    else
      TLBTranslate(vAddr, Instruction)
}

let have_cp2 = false

function unit SignalException ((Exception) ex) = SignalExceptionMIPS(ex, 0x0000000000000000)

function unit ERETHook() = ()
